Chapter 8
Start-Up

8-2

2.

Check terminal block connections as described in Chapter 5 and
Appendix B.

3.

Set switches S1 (A Quad B Board) and SW1 (top of drive) as
explained in Switch Settings in Chapter 5

4.

Assure that the drive circuit breaker (MCB), contactor (M) and
Enable input are OFF (de-energized).

5.

Apply power to the input transformer primary, but Do Not Enable
the drive or energize the contactor (M). The Enable LED should be
Off.

6.

Using a voltmeter, verify that the voltages listed below are present at
the locations shown. The tolerance for all voltages is

±

10%. Clear

faults before replacing any blown fuses. Refer to Chapter 11 for test
point locations.

Location

Voltage

TB5-4 to TB5-5

230V AC

TB5-4 to TB5-6

230V AC

TB5-5 to TB5-6

230V AC

TB4-21 to TB4-19

36V AC

TP13 to TP12

+12V DC

TP14 to TP12

–12V DC

7.

Remove all power to the transformer.

8.

The wires connected to terminals 9 and 10 of TB2 must be marked
and removed to allow for local operation of the enable circuit.
Connect a suitable temporary switch between these terminals and
insulate the switch connections.

9.

Once control connections are made:

a) Open the enable switch – the ENABLE LED will be Off.

b) Apply power to the transformer primary.

c) Place the circuit breaker (MCB) to the On position.

d) Energize the contactor (M). The STATUS LED should illuminate

to a steady green.

Important: If power is applied while the drive is enabled, the
STATUS LED will flash red and disable the drive. The drive may be
reset by removing the Enable signal and momentarily grounding the
Reset terminal (TB2-11). An alternate method would be to remove
and reapply the branch circuit or drive power (36V) with the Enable
input removed.
